Spring Centerpiece
Looking for a way to channel your spring fever? Create a beautiful spring centerpiece with your child! Featuring bursts of colorful flowers and a few buzzing bees, this will be a family art project you'll want to display throughout the season.

What You Need:
- Foam square
- Fake silk butterflies
- Small fake flowers
- Glue
- Fake plastic bees
- Vinyl place mat
- Dried floral moss
What You Do:
- Put the foam square on the vinyl place man and start covering it with glue. Encourage your child to get a little messy! They can use their hands to spread the glue all over the foam. Just make sure they doesn't get in any glue on the bottom of the square.
- Give your child the dried floral moss and let them stick it all over the foam square. When they're done, no part of the foam should be visible.
- Now it's time to decorate! Let your child stick the fake flowers and butterflies into the moss. You won't need any glue for this step. The foam square should secure all your decorative pieces.
- Squeeze a drop of glue onto each plastic bee. Let your child place the bees onto the moss.
- Find somewhere to put your spring centerpiece on display! Encourage your child to be on the lookout for more flowers and insects they can stick into the centerpiece -- it's a project they never have to stop building and improving.
Use this fun seasonal activity as a launch pad for some spring-themed talk! Do they know why we associate flowers with springtime? What's their favorite spring activity?
